菜鸟编程软件主要有易语言、QBasic和Scratch,其中Scratch 是专为儿童设计的一款编程软件,它允许用户通过拼接积木块的方式来编写程序,极大地降低了编程的入门难度。在这里,我们将重点介绍 Scratch。
Scratch 是由麻省理工学院的终身幼儿园团队开发的。它使用图形化编程界面,用户不需要编写代码,而是通过拖动和放置代码块来形成程序。Scratch的设计理念是使编程更加直观且易于理解,这特别适合编程初学者和儿童使用。通过使用 Scratch,初学者可以学习基本的编程概念,如循环、条件语句和变量,同时在创造游戏、动画和互动故事的过程中增强他们的创造力和逻辑思维能力。
一、编程软件的教育意义
编程教育对于培养逻辑思维和解决问题的能力至关重要。在21世纪这个信息爆炸的时代,学习编程不仅仅是为了成为一名程序员,而是为了培养能够适应未来社会的关键能力。随着人工智能、大数据和互联网技术的迅猛发展,掌握编程知识已经成为一种基本的文化素养。
二、SCRATCH的用户界面与操作
Scratch的用户界面简洁而直观。它分为几个区域:舞台区、精灵列表、代码区、积木块区和操作面板。用户可以通过拖拽积木块到代码区来编排不同的程序指令,生成有趣的动画、游戏或互动故事。这种所见即所得的编程方式,大大降低了编写程序的技术壁垒,使得非技术背景的用户也能轻松入门。
三、编程初学者通过SCRATCH学习的优势
Scratch让编程变得生动有趣,它鼓励创造与分享精神。使用者在构建项目的同时,可以将其公布在Scratch在线社区,与世界各地的其他创作者交流和合作。这种社区互助的学习环境不仅能够激发学习者的兴趣,还能够帮助他们学习到合作和交流的重要性。
四、易语言与QBASIC的概述
除了 Scratch 外,还有其他几种针对初学者的编程软件。例如,易语言是一种简体中文的编程语言,它拥有强大的中文处理能力,非常适合中国编程初学者。而QBasic,是一个老牌的编程软件,虽然现在已经相对落后,但它简单的语法和命令仍然使得它在教育领域中保持着一席之地。这些工具都是为了降低编程的入门门槛,让更多的人能够接触和学习编程。
五、如何选择合适的编程学习工具
选择编程学习工具时,应根据学习者的年龄、兴趣和学习目标来决定。对于儿童和编程初学者,Scratch无疑是最好的选择,因为它的游戏化特性可以激发学习者的兴趣。而对于想要进一步学习具体软件开发或系统编程的学习者,可以尝试易语言、Python等其他编程语言。总的来说,选择合适的学习工具对于编程学习者来说十分重要。
六、结合实际项目加深编程理解
在学习编程的过程中,实践是巩固和深化理解的重要手段。通过实际的项目,可以将理论知识应用到实际操作中,不仅能提高编程能力,还能增加面对真实问题时的解决能力。因此,无论是选择 Scratch 还是其他编程工具,都应该鼓励学习者参与到具体的、实际的开发项目之中。
七、未来编程教育的发展趋势
随着技术的持续发展,编程教育呈现出多样化和普及化的趋势。越来越多的编程工具和资源变得容易获取和使用。在线编程课程和教育平台使得远程学习变得可能。同时,以编程为基础的跨学科学习模式正在兴起,将编程与数学、科学和艺术等领域结合起来,为编程教育注入了新的活力。
在这样的大背景下,选择一款适合自己的编程工具,开始探索编程的世界,对于每个人来说都是一次新的挑战也是一个新的机遇。通过编程,不仅能开拓科技前沿,还能激发无限的创造潜力。
相关问答FAQs:
Q: 菜鸟中文编程软件叫什么?
A: 菜鸟中文编程软件的名字是“菜鸟教程”。菜鸟教程是一个非常受欢迎的在线学习平台,提供大量的编程教程和学习资源。它以简洁易懂的中文讲解,帮助初学者快速入门编程技术。
菜鸟教程提供了多种编程语言的教程,包括Java、Python、C++、JavaScript等。无论你是完全的编程新手还是有一定基础的学习者,都可以在菜鸟教程找到适合自己的教程和学习资料。
除了编程教程,菜鸟教程还提供了在线编程练习和编程项目的实践,帮助学习者巩固所学知识并应用到实际项目中。这对于想要提高编程技能和实践能力的学习者来说非常有帮助。
总而言之,菜鸟教程是一款非常受欢迎的中文编程学习软件,在线提供大量的编程教程、练习和实践项目,适合初学者和有一定基础的学习者使用。
Q: 菜鸟教程能够帮助我学习哪些编程语言?
A: 菜鸟教程提供了多种编程语言的教程,涵盖了很多常用的编程语言。以下是菜鸟教程可帮助你学习的一些编程语言:
-
Java: Java是一种强大且广泛使用的编程语言,菜鸟教程提供了Java编程的入门教程和高级教程,帮助你从基础开始学习并掌握Java编程技巧。
-
Python: Python是一种易学且功能强大的编程语言,菜鸟教程提供了Python编程的基础和进阶教程,帮助你快速掌握Python编程的核心概念和语法。
-
C++: C++是一种面向对象编程语言,广泛应用于系统和游戏开发等领域。菜鸟教程提供了C++编程的入门和高级教程,帮助你深入了解C++语言的特性和应用。
-
JavaScript: JavaScript是一种用于网页开发的脚本语言,菜鸟教程提供了JavaScript编程的入门和进阶教程,帮助你学习如何在网页中添加交互性和动态效果。
除了以上提到的语言,菜鸟教程还覆盖了其他编程语言,例如C#、PHP、Ruby等。你可以根据自己的兴趣和需求选择适合自己的教程进行学习。
Q: 菜鸟教程提供的编程教程有多实用?
A: 菜鸟教程提供的编程教程非常实用。以下是一些菜鸟教程的特点和优势:
-
清晰易懂的中文讲解:菜鸟教程以简洁易懂的中文讲解编程概念和技巧,帮助初学者更好地理解和掌握编程知识。
-
丰富的示例代码:菜鸟教程的编程教程通常会提供大量的示例代码,让学习者可以通过实际代码来理解和应用所学知识。
-
实践项目和练习:除了教程,菜鸟教程还提供了实践项目和编程练习,帮助学习者在实际项目中应用所学知识,并提供机会进行实际操作和练习。
-
社区交流和支持:菜鸟教程拥有庞大的用户社区,学习者可以在社区中与其他编程爱好者交流和互动,共同学习和提高。
总体而言,菜鸟教程提供的编程教程实用且有趣,适合不同水平和背景的学习者使用。无论你是编程新手还是有一定经验的学习者,菜鸟教程都能帮助你快速入门并提高编程技能。
文章标题:菜鸟中文编程软件叫什么,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/2078248